ON THE BEHAVIOR OF STEADY TIME-HARMONIC OSCILLATIONS IN THERMOELASTIC MATERIALS WITH VOIDS
Authors:Antonio Scalia  Anna Pompei  Stan Chiri??
Affiliation:1. Department of Mathematics , Catania, Italy;2. University of Ia?i , Ia?i, Romania
Abstract:We study the spatial behavior in a cylinder made of an isotropic and homogeneous thermoelastic material with voids when it is subjected to plane boundary data varying harmonically in time on its lateral surface and on one of the bases. For oscillations with an angular frequency lower than a critical frequency, we show that some appropriate measures associated with the amplitude of the vibration decays exponentially with the distance to the bases.
Keywords:time-harmonic oscillations  spatial decay  thermoelastic materials with voids
